The three major feasts
1) The Passover
    Lamb sacrificed at 9am
    Lamb put in oven at 3pm
    Sacrifice covers sins


Correlates to Jesus crucified at 9am, buried at 3pm. However, Jesus REMOVES our sins.
1 Cor 5:7 Jesus didn’t cover our sins, Jesus removed our sins. These sins that are removed cannot come back to haunt you.

2) Pentecost
     Pentecost means 50. In Exodus, Cloud descended with loud noise and God wrote His law on tablets, later 3000 people died from worshiping golden calf.
     When The Holy Spirit came upon believers with a loud noise, The Holy Spirit became our teacher that day & 3000 people were added unto the body.
